4021048. FERDINAND BARBEDIENNE (1810-1892). Venus de Milo.

Description

Ferdinand Barbedienne (1810-1892), Venus de Milo, bronze, 19th century, signed 'F. Barbedienne Fondeur' and with the foundry stamp 'Reduction mecanique A. Collas', height approx. 31 cm

Ferdinand Barbedienne joined forces in 1838 with the mechanic Achille Collas, who had developed the 'machine á reduction' (Reducteur for short) in 1837. With this device, three-dimensional objects of any size — reduced or enlarged — could be reproduced. Together, they ran one of the most important bronze foundries in France and produced smaller casts of numerous famous ancient sculptures.
